The Emotional Impact of Moody Walls
Moody wallpaper has the unique ability to shape the emotional experience of a room. Deep blues, rich greens, charcoal grays, and even velvety blacks convey calm, mystery, and elegance. These tones are perfect for bedrooms, lounges, and home offices where a sense of sanctuary is desired. Pattern choice further amplifies the mood: subtle geometrics add structure, abstract swirls create movement, and floral or botanical motifs bring a touch of natural softness. The combination of hue and design allows homeowners to tailor their interiors to specific feelings, whether that’s cozy comfort, creative energy, or refined drama.
Texture as a Trend-Setter
In 2025, texture is a key element in moody wallpaper design. Beyond traditional flat prints, embossed surfaces, metallic highlights, and tactile finishes are gaining popularity. These textures catch light in different ways, adding depth and sophistication to any wall. Designers are experimenting with layering textures in unexpected combinations – matte backgrounds with glossy motifs or rough-hewn patterns with delicate metallic accents – to create walls that feel alive and engaging.
Mixing Modern and Classic Aesthetics
Another trend in moody wallpaper is blending modern sensibilities with classic inspirations. Art deco patterns, mid-century geometrics, and Victorian-inspired botanicals are being reinterpreted in dark, moody palettes. This fusion allows for spaces that feel timeless yet contemporary, giving interiors a curated, high-end look. For example, a living room might combine a deep emerald wallpaper with velvet upholstery and brass accents, creating an environment that is both luxurious and inviting.
Small Spaces, Big Impact
Moody wallpaper is also increasingly used to transform small spaces. Narrow hallways, powder rooms, or reading nooks can become striking focal points when treated with deep, richly patterned walls. Designers advise pairing dark walls with strategic lighting and lighter furnishings to prevent a space from feeling cramped. Accents like mirrors, metallic fixtures, and art pieces can amplify the drama while maintaining balance.
Sustainability and Innovation
Sustainability has become an important consideration in wallpaper production. Many new moody wallpapers are now made with eco-friendly inks and recyclable materials without compromising on quality or richness of color. Additionally, peel-and-stick options make installation and removal easy, reducing waste and allowing homeowners to update their interiors with minimal environmental impact.
Styling Tips for 2025
To make the most of moody wallpaper, designers suggest a few key strategies:
- Contrast and Balance: Pair dark walls with lighter furniture, textiles, or architectural details to create visual contrast.
- Statement Ceilings: Applying moody wallpaper to a ceiling can dramatically alter perception of space, adding depth and surprise.
- Layering with Art: Use framed artwork, mirrors, or metallic accents to add dimension and interest against rich backgrounds.
- Complementary Textures: Combine velvet, leather, or linen with textured wallpaper to achieve a tactile and inviting environment.
